Defining AI Trading Bots and Core Concepts

AI trading bots represent sophisticated software programs designed to execute financial transactions automatically across global markets. These advanced algorithms leverage machine learning techniques to analyze complex market data, identify trading opportunities, and make split-second decisions without human intervention. Advanced AI trading techniques have transformed how traders approach financial markets by introducing unprecedented levels of computational precision and strategic analysis.

At their core, AI trading bots utilize complex mathematical models and statistical algorithms to process massive datasets from financial exchanges. These systems continuously learn from historical market patterns, price movements, trading volumes, and global economic indicators to develop predictive trading strategies. Unlike traditional manual trading approaches, AI bots can simultaneously monitor multiple currency pairs, analyze intricate market signals, and execute trades within milliseconds - capabilities far beyond human cognitive limitations.

The fundamental architecture of AI trading bots typically involves several critical components: data collection mechanisms, machine learning models, risk management protocols, and automated execution systems. Machine learning algorithms enable these bots to adapt and improve their strategies over time, learning from both successful and unsuccessful trades to refine their decision-making processes. Advanced neural networks and deep learning techniques allow these systems to recognize subtle market patterns that human traders might overlook, potentially generating more consistent trading performance.

Types of AI Trading Bots for Forex and Gold

AI trading bots in forex and gold markets are sophisticated technological solutions categorized by their strategic approaches and computational capabilities. Specialized trading bot strategies enable traders to leverage advanced algorithmic techniques designed for specific market conditions and asset classes. These bots are typically classified into distinct categories based on their operational methodologies, market focus, and analytical frameworks.

Analyst configures forex AI trading bots

The primary types of AI trading bots for forex and gold markets include trend-following bots, mean reversion bots, arbitrage bots, and sentiment analysis bots. Trend-following bots identify and capitalize on sustained price movements, using machine learning algorithms to detect emerging market directions. Mean reversion bots operate on the principle that asset prices tend to return to historical average levels, executing trades when prices deviate significantly from established baselines. Arbitrage bots exploit price discrepancies across different exchanges, generating profits from temporary market inefficiencies.

Sentiment analysis bots represent a more advanced category, integrating natural language processing techniques to evaluate market sentiment from news sources, social media, and economic reports. Hybrid AI trading models combine multiple analytical approaches, integrating technical indicators, fundamental analysis, and machine learning predictions to create more robust trading strategies. These sophisticated systems can adapt dynamically to changing market conditions, offering traders unprecedented flexibility and computational trading capabilities across forex and gold markets.

Here is a summary comparing major types of AI trading bots used in forex and gold markets:

Bot TypePrimary Market FocusStrengthsTypical Limitations
Trend-FollowingForex and GoldCaptures sustained trendsVulnerable during sideways markets
Mean ReversionForex and GoldProfits from price correctionsRisky in strong trend phases
ArbitrageMulti-exchange AssetsExploits price differencesDependent on market efficiency
Sentiment AnalysisNews/Social MediaReacts to market mood shiftsMay misinterpret rapid sentiment
Hybrid ModelsAll asset classesCombines several strategiesComplexity may increase errors

Key Features and How AI Bots Work

AI trading bots operate through complex computational processes that transform market data into strategic trading decisions. Advanced bot operational mechanisms enable these sophisticated systems to continuously analyze financial markets, generating trading signals with remarkable precision and speed. The fundamental architecture of these bots involves multiple interconnected components designed to process, interpret, and act upon real-time market information.

The core functionality of AI trading bots centers around three primary stages: data collection, signal generation, and trade execution. During the data collection phase, bots aggregate massive volumes of market data from multiple sources, including price movements, trading volumes, economic indicators, and historical price patterns. Machine learning algorithms then analyze this data, identifying potential trading opportunities by detecting complex market patterns that human traders might miss. Signal generation involves sophisticated mathematical models that evaluate the collected data against predefined trading strategies, determining optimal entry and exit points with computational efficiency.

Infographic of AI bot features and benefits

Key features of advanced AI trading bots include continuous 24/7 market monitoring, automated risk management, and adaptive learning capabilities. These systems implement advanced techniques like automated stop-loss mechanisms, portfolio rebalancing, and dynamic strategy adjustment based on real-time market conditions. Machine learning enables these bots to continuously improve their performance by analyzing previous trade outcomes, refining their algorithms, and developing more sophisticated trading approaches that can adapt to changing market dynamics. The ability to process vast amounts of information simultaneously gives AI trading bots a significant computational advantage over traditional manual trading methods.

This table highlights essential features of advanced AI trading bots and their impact on trading outcomes:

FeatureHow It WorksImpact on Trading
24/7 Market MonitoringConstant data analysisFaster opportunity detection
Automated Risk ControlBuilt-in stop-loss/rebalancingLimits losses automatically
Adaptive LearningRefines strategy from trade historyImproved performance over time
Multi-Asset SupportTrades across various marketsGreater diversification
Millisecond ExecutionExecutes trades nearly instantlyTakes advantage of volatility

Risks, Misconceptions, and What to Avoid

AI trading bots are not infallible financial instruments, and traders must approach them with a critical and informed perspective. AI trading bot limitations reveal significant risks that can potentially undermine trading performance if not carefully managed. The primary misconception is that these automated systems guarantee consistent profits, when in reality they represent complex tools requiring sophisticated understanding and continuous monitoring.

One of the most critical risks involves the potential for overfitting, where AI algorithms become excessively tailored to historical market data that may not accurately predict future market conditions. Traders frequently encounter challenges such as data bias, where machine learning models inadvertently incorporate historical prejudices or incomplete market representations. These limitations can lead to unexpected trading outcomes, particularly during unprecedented economic events or sudden market volatility that fall outside the bot’s original training parameters.

Traders must be vigilant about several key misconceptions surrounding AI trading technologies. Understanding trading bot risks requires recognizing that no algorithm can completely eliminate market uncertainty. Technical failures, liquidity constraints, and regulatory changes can dramatically impact bot performance. Successful implementation demands continuous strategy refinement, realistic performance expectations, and a comprehensive risk management approach that includes regular performance audits, diversification of trading strategies, and maintaining human oversight to interpret complex market signals that algorithmic systems might misunderstand.
